Cost of hyperbaric oxygen therapy

Hyperbaric oxygen therapy (HBOT) is really a therapy that raises the level of oxygen inside your bloodstream. The oxygen Improve encourages Your whole body to mobilize stem cells and maintenance harmed tissues. Several forms of HBOT can handle several different problems. The cost of HBOT could vary, and is best talked over with your healthcare service provider.

A session lasts a bit in excess of two hours, and is usually scheduled as soon as every day, five times a week. Dependant upon the problem, you could demand approximately 30 periods. Some insurance policies vendors protect these treatments, even though they do not deal with the price of various therapies.

HBOT can be extremely costly. For the majority of disorders, it's well worth the expense. Just one session of hard HBOT in the hyperbaric clinic can Charge involving $230 and $2400. You may also go along with comfortable HBOT at home, which could Price tag in between $75-$150 for each session with a portable chamber and oxygen concentrator.
